PMFJI but I wanted to point out the default in Mail is to send large attachments via Mail Drop and the size limit is 5GB. While I am aware of your reluctance to use iCloud, but, instead of using email attachments consider iCloud File Sharing. It is very secure, iCloud is encrypted, iCloud file transfers are end to end encrypted, you can share the file with "anyone that has the url" or "only those you invite". Videos will not "stream" from the cloud, but they will download easily and file sizes can range all the way up to 50GB.
